Форум программистов, компьютерный форум CyberForum.ru

N-мерный массив в векторе - C++

Восстановить пароль Регистрация
 
Tein
0 / 0 / 0
Регистрация: 07.05.2014
Сообщений: 4
24.11.2014, 10:58     N-мерный массив в векторе #1
Здравствуйте. Можно ли в векторе хранить n-мерный массив. т.е. я с клавиатуры ввожу размерность n массива и потом заполняю сам массив.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
24.11.2014, 10:58     N-мерный массив в векторе
Посмотрите здесь:

C++ про функции и 2х мерный массив
Двух мерный массив. C++
n-мерный массив C++
C++ динамический 2-х мерный массив
2-х мерный массив. C++
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
-THE_MASTER666-
Заблокирован
24.11.2014, 11:13     N-мерный массив в векторе #2
C++
1
std::vector<std::vector<int>> data;
размер произвольный, вручную не обязательно что - то вводить

Добавлено через 8 минут
если хочешь именно массив определённого размера в векторе, тогда что - то в этом духе:
C++
1
2
3
4
5
int size = 0;
std::cin >> size;
int* item = new int[size];
std::vector<int*> data;
data.push_back(item);
Tein
0 / 0 / 0
Регистрация: 07.05.2014
Сообщений: 4
24.11.2014, 13:17  [ТС]     N-мерный массив в векторе #3
То есть с этим кодом я смогу сначала ввести мерность матрицы(например 4х мерная матрица) а потом заполнить ее своими элементами?
-THE_MASTER666-
Заблокирован
24.11.2014, 13:20     N-мерный массив в векторе #4
сможешь
Yandex
Объявления
24.11.2014, 13:20     N-мерный массив в векторе
Ответ Создать тему
Опции темы

Текущее время: 17:00.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ru